1. The Westin Zagreb – Gay Friendly Hotel Zagreb

This 5-star hotel in Zagreb is within walking distance to the centre and outdoor cafés. The Westin offers free internet access and houses the World Class Health Academy spa centre.The Westin Zagreb offers a 1,500 m² big fitness area, with state-of-the-art exercise equipment, a 17 m pool, an oversized Jacuzzi as well as Finnish and Turkish saunas. What can you expect more for a romantic weekend in Zagreb? With the Jacuzzi and Saunas we don’t need anymore to exit this gay friendly hotel in Zagreb!

The Westin is a big US-style hotel located close to the business district in Zagreb.

The hotel is situated within a 15 – 30 min walk to most site of Zagreb. There are restaurants and shops all within walking distance.  (Zagreb is a relatively safe city so we were fine being out at night. As always, be aware of pickpockets.)

Rooms are a good size by European standards, well appointed, with a comfortable bed.  Rooms are  spacious, well equipped, very clean and functional.

2. Esplanade Zagreb Hotel – Gay Friendly Hotel Zagreb

Esplanade Hotel Zagreb
Esplanade Hotel Zagreb

Situated in Zagreb city centre, right next to the Zagreb Main Railway Station, 5-star Esplanade Zagreb Hotel offers a fitness centre and sauna. Free WiFi access is featured throughout the hotel. Guests can enjoy a meal at the hotel restaurant’s terrace or have a drink served by the award-winning cocktail bartenders.  Its nouveau style rooms offer satellite TV and a minibar, while the marble bathrooms include a bathtub and shower and complimentary L’Occitane cosmetics.

The city is clean, feels very safe, and architecturally authentic. It has lots of gardens; a perfect outdoor craft, flower, and fresh food market in the very center of the city; and lots of cafes within easy walking distance of the Esplanade.

The hotel is within walking distance of the station and the central square of Zagreb can be reached on foot in 10 minutes. The hotel has grandeur and is the place for the fine fleur of Zagreb and the rest of Croatia

3. Hotel Jagerhorn Zagreb – Gay Friendly Hotel 

Situated between the main pedestrian street and Zagreb’s old town close to Ban Jelacic Square, this hotel was refurbished in 2011. Founded in 1827, Hotel Jagerhorn is the city’s oldest standing hotel.
The elegantly equipped rooms provide free Wi-Fi internet access. Free secure parking is located nearby.

Hotel Jagerhorn has a unique location : bang in the center of all the action in Zagreb and yet a little retracted from the road, so that there is no noise. We will be  pleasantly surprised with the soothing chirping of birds.

Hotel is situated very near to town central, super convenient where all the churches are situated with plenty of eateries within walking distance.

The adjacent cafe was also a great resource for a quick snack, wine or coffee with friends as well. The front of the hotel lead right to restaurants and shopping while the back lead to a set of stairs that brought you to Upper town in the center of all of the historic buildings.

The Jägerhorn is a ‘hotel garni’, not possessing a restaurant, but there is a spacious bar for alcoholic drinks, coffee and cakes.
